Jon Bon Jovi Gets Special Visit From Vince Neil

Vince Neil stopped into Jon Bon Jovi’s new Nashville bar. The Mötley Crüe singer posted a video on Instagram of his visit and captioned it: “So proud of my buddy, Jon Bon Jovi. Your new Nashville bar and record are great!”

Recent Bon Jovi Concert Details
Jon Bon Jovi performed a surprise five-song performance in Nashville on June 7 to commemorate the launch of JBJ’s rooftop bar and restaurant. The concert also marked the release of their sixteenth album, ‘Forever.’ Jon’s voice comeback following 2022 surgery made this concert important. Recent comments indicate he can sing again but cannot manage extensive tours. During the Nashville club event, the frontman’s voice was off yet forceful. Bon Jovi danced and sang on the little stage, as usual. First up was ‘Blood on Blood,’ a song not performed live since 2019. The singer then discussed his hiatus and how nice it felt to perform again: “I haven’t performed in front of a house audience in two years. Way too long. It feels fantastic. I hope it sounds nice because it feels fantastic. ”The band wrote and recorded in Nashville, so he stressed its significance. Jelly Roll, Big Kenny, and others attended. They sang ‘You Give Love a Bad Name’ and ‘Legendary’ from ‘Forever.’
